G4... I'm guessing you meant S4.

It could be your USB ports on your computer, or old drivers... try a different USB port. You might also want to check to see what drivers are loaded on your PC... at least I'm guessing it is a PC and not a Mac... I have no idea what to do with a Mac. I've had a number of Android devices as you tell below and my only issue is old drivers that are still on my laptop, until I change USB ports... my S4 charges just fine using my old USB cables and my old chargers.

Also check your USB cables, I only have 2-3 cables that will work with this phone. Did you try using the white one that comes with it? That one works the best.

Just wanted to pass on what I did to get my Android tablet charging. I tried a lot of different things and it came down to charging just my tablet with no other items charging at the same time. I suspect for some reason inadequate amps when other item charging. Why and how I don't know. But charging ok now.
